Comprehending the Types of Fireplaces
Before diving into the practicalities of purchasing a fireplace, it's vital to comprehend the different types readily available. Each type has its unique advantages and considerations. Here's a breakdown:

When looking for a fireplace, several elements play an important function in making the right option. Here are some essential factors to consider:

Space and Layout: Measure the area where you wish to set up the fireplace. Guarantee it fits your area without overcrowding.

Heating Needs: Assess your home's heating requirements. If you reside in a colder environment, you may want a more effective heating source.

Fuel Type: Choose a fuel type that lines up with your way of life and preferences. For circumstances, wood-burning fireplaces use a rustic charm but need effort, whereas gas fireplaces supply convenience.

Installation: Understand the setup procedure. Some fireplaces require expert installation, while others can be more DIY-friendly.

Style and Design: Fireplaces come in different styles. Consider your home's decoration and select a style that complements it.

Spending plan: Set a budget plan for both the fireplace itself and the installation costs.

How much does it cost to set up a fireplace?
The installation expenses can differ widely based on the type of fireplace, the intricacy of the setup, and any needed renovations. On average, anticipate to pay between ₤ 1,500 and ₤ 5,000, including installation.
2. Do I need a permit to set up a fireplace?
The majority of locations need authorizations for fireplace installation, especially for wood- and gas-burning units. Consult your regional building department for particular policies.
3. How typically should I get my fireplace serviced?
For wood-burning and gas fireplaces, it is advised to have them serviced a minimum of once a year to ensure they run safely and effectively.
4. Can I set up a fireplace myself?
Some electrical and ventless designs are more DIY-friendly, while others might require professional setup to meet local codes. Constantly describe the producer's standards.
5. Are there any energy-efficient fireplaces?
Yes, there are lots of energy-efficient alternatives, especially gas and pellet ranges, which can supply significant heating while minimizing energy consumption.
